Call for Proposals: IES Research Pods

The Institute for European Studies is inviting applications for IES Faculty Research Pods. The research pods are a new initiative designed to bring together small teams of researchers from across Cornell, who collaborate to organize activities focused on a research theme related to European Studies.

Research pod activities should aim to bring faculty together to discuss, collaborate, workshop, or advance research ideas, but the specific activities are flexible. Funding could be allocated to organizing a series of meetings or workshops, inviting an external collaborator to campus, hiring hourly student support, or coordinating any form of community event relating to the specific research theme. Successful applications will demonstrate the potential for long-term collaboration. Expenses involving data collection or research activities will be considered, but applicants must justify this activity toward the goal of fostering sustained collaboration.

Funding for IES Research Pods will be up to $3,000 for the year.

To apply, please submit a proposal (up to 1,000 words) to ies@cornell.edu with the subject titled “IES Research Pod Application.” The application should include the names and affiliations of all Cornell researchers involved in the pod’s initial formation, and the proposed activities of the pod. We hope to award the first set of research pod seed funding by the end of 2022, with applications considered on a rolling basis.
